The women’s 400m hurdles finals had athletes on two completely opposite ends of the spectrum of emotions. On one hand you had Femke Bol, reclaiming her 2022 World Championships title, fending off the competition with a world-leading run. After the race, Bol was all smiles with the medal around her neck and the flag of the Netherlands slung around her shoulders. And on the other, you had Dalilah Muhammad, a former world and Olympic champion, who placed seventh and bade an emotional farewell to the sport.
